90比分,实时足球比分 localhost解析90比分即时足球比分 localhost

90比分,实时足球比分 localhost解析90比分即时足球比分 localhost,

本文目录导读:

  1. 90比分是什么?
  2. 90比分的实时更新机制
  3. 90比分的技术细节
  4. 90比分的用户界面设计
  5. 90比分的未来发展

在现代足球运动中,实时比分一直是球迷们关注的焦点,无论是在线观看比赛,还是通过手机实时更新比分,足球迷们总是希望能掌握最新动态,而“90比分”作为一个知名的实时足球比分平台,凭借其高更新率和准确性,成为了众多足球爱好者的心头好,本文将深入解析“90比分”及其技术实现,帮助读者全面了解这一平台的工作原理。

90比分是什么?

90比分是一款实时足球比分平台,提供即时足球比分、积分榜、联赛动态等内容,用户可以通过访问90比分的官方网站或通过 localhost 地址来查看最新比赛结果,无论是英超、西甲、意甲等欧洲顶级联赛,还是中国、巴西等其他联赛,90比分都能提供实时更新的比分数据。

90比分的技术实现

要理解90比分是如何工作的,我们需要从服务器端和客户端两个方面来分析。

服务器端

  1. 数据采集
    90比分的服务器端主要负责从多个足球平台(如 ESPN、FIFA、Live Soccer 等)抓取实时比分数据,这些平台会定期发布最新的比赛结果,90比分的服务器会通过网络请求获取这些数据。

  2. 数据处理
    接收到数据后,服务器会进行数据清洗和处理,去除重复记录、处理时间格式不一致等问题,服务器还会对数据进行格式转换,使其符合数据库的要求。

  3. 数据库存储
    处理好的数据会被存储在数据库中,我们会使用 MySQL 或 PostgreSQL 等关系型数据库,因为它们支持快速查询和高效处理大量数据,具体存储结构包括比赛ID、比赛时间、比分、主队、客队、进球时间、进球球员等信息。

  4. 数据发布
    数据存储完毕后,服务器会通过 RESTful API 接口向客户端发送数据,这些接口通常会返回 JSON 格式的数据,方便前端应用进行处理。

客户端

  1. HTTP 请求
    用户通过浏览器发送 HTTP 请求到 90比分 的官方网站或 localhost 地址,发送 GET 请求到 http://localhost:8080

  2. 数据解析
    接收的 JSON 数据会被前端代码解析,提取出所需的比分信息,提取出比赛ID、比分、主队、客队等数据。

  3. 数据展示
    解析后的数据会被前端代码渲染到页面上,显示比赛的比分、进球时间、球员名单等信息。

  4. 用户交互
    用户可以通过页面上的按钮或输入框进行交互,例如查看历史比赛、设置提醒、与其他用户互动等。

90比分的实时更新机制

90比分的实时更新机制依赖于服务器端和客户端的高效协作,以下是具体的实现步骤:

  1. 数据抓取
    服务器端会定期向多个足球平台发送抓取请求,获取最新的比赛数据,这些请求通常会使用 GET 方法,GET /api/matchsticks/

  2. 数据同步
    服务器端会将抓取到的数据与本地数据库进行对比,如果发现数据不一致,服务器会自动更新数据库。

  3. 数据发布
    服务器端会通过 RESTful API 接口向客户端发送更新的数据,这些接口通常会返回 JSON 格式的数据,{ "status": "success", "data": { "match_id": "12345", "score": "2-1", "home_team": "Team A", "away_team": "Team B" } }

  4. 客户端处理
    用户端会接收到数据后,进行数据解析和展示,前端代码会将 JSON 数据转换为 HTML 页面,显示最新的比分。

90比分的技术细节

为了确保90比分的实时更新和数据准确性,服务器端需要具备以下技术能力:

  1. 高并发处理
    服务器端需要能够同时处理大量的抓取请求,如果同时有1000个用户访问90比分,服务器端需要能够快速响应。

  2. 数据一致性
    服务器端需要确保数据的高可用性和一致性,使用 ACID 数据库操作,避免数据不一致的问题。

  3. 负载均衡
    服务器端需要使用负载均衡技术,将请求分配到多个服务器上,避免单个服务器过载。

  4. 数据压缩
    为了提高数据传输效率,服务器端可以对数据进行压缩,使用 gzip 压缩算法,减少数据传输量。

90比分的用户界面设计

用户界面是90比分用户体验的重要组成部分,以下是用户界面设计的关键点:

  1. 简洁明了
    用户界面需要简洁明了,让用户能够快速找到所需的信息,使用清晰的层级结构,将比分、积分、排名等信息分门别类。

  2. 响应式设计
    用户界面需要支持响应式设计,适应不同设备的屏幕尺寸,手机和平板的显示效果不同,用户界面需要在不同设备上进行适配。

  3. 交互性
    用户界面需要具备良好的交互性,点击按钮后能够立即显示结果,或者输入框可以实时更新。

  4. 视觉效果
    用户界面需要具备良好的视觉效果,使用吸引人的颜色、字体和布局,提升用户体验。

90比分的未来发展

90比分作为实时足球比分平台,未来的发展方向包括:

  1. 扩展数据来源
    90比分可以考虑扩展数据来源,加入更多足球平台的数据,或者引入直播数据。

  2. 引入AI技术
    90比分可以考虑引入 AI 技术,预测比赛结果、推荐比赛录像等。

  3. 开发移动应用
    90比分可以开发移动应用,方便用户随时随地查看比赛结果。

  4. 与合作伙伴合作
    90比分可以与足球平台、直播商等合作,获取更多数据和资源。

90比分是一款功能强大、实时更新的足球比分平台,凭借其高更新率和准确性,成为众多足球爱好者的心头好,通过本文的解析,我们了解了90比分的技术实现,包括服务器端的数据采集、处理、存储和发布,以及客户端的用户界面设计,90比分可以通过扩展数据来源、引入 AI 技术、开发移动应用等手段,进一步提升用户体验,无论是对于足球迷还是对于技术开发者,90比分都提供了丰富的资源和机遇。

90比分,实时足球比分 localhost解析90比分即时足球比分 localhost,

发表评论